This video tutorial covers quadratic models, explaining their structure and key features such as the y-intercept, x-intercepts, and axis of symmetry. It provides two examples: the first demonstrates how to find a quadratic model using given points, and the second explores finding the roots and minimum value of a quadratic model. The tutorial also includes instructions on using a calculator to solve simultaneous equations.
